# spoolerd — printer-spooler microservice (team Inkwell)
# New folks: this env file drives the local dev instance only.
# Queue backend is the in-memory driver unless SPOOL_BACKEND is set.
# Max job size is capped at 25MB; raise it and the renderer will OOM.
# Don't commit changes to this file. Ask in the team channel before
# touching retry settings. The broker auth token is set on the next line.

sealed setting: VAULT_KEY20=69e2a0b23f1a79fbf692

## Releases

Quillbarrow 4.x builds are now fully hermetic under the Fennet toolchain. Network fetches during compile are blocked; vendor all plugin deps into `third_party/`. Legacy Makefile targets are gone — use `fennet build //plugin:dist`. Release artifacts are reproducible byte-for-byte across builders. Verify any downloaded plugin SDK tarball against the maintainer key below.

release key, kahif-yagap: bky3_1JN

# Striderline chip-reader config.
# Reader polls RFID mats every 200ms; split times buffer locally,
# flush to central DB every 5s. Don't touch the antenna gain values
# unless the Millbrook course crew signs off. Clock sync via the
# Pacerton NTP box at the finish truck. Duplicate reads within 2s
# are deduped downstream, not here. Failed flushes retry with backoff.
# Flushes target the database given by the connection string below.

replica DSN, kajep-yahag: mssql://praok_svc:iF@db-8d68.plorvaio.local:5432/eliion

**Q: Are the lifts running this weekend?** No. Both lifts in the Halloway Annexe are down for winch maintenance Saturday 06:00 to Sunday 18:00. Direct staff to the east stairwell. Goods deliveries should be deferred or rerouted via the Penfold loading dock. Contractors from Bray Vertical Systems will be on site; they sign in at the facilities desk as normal. The stairwell door locks after 19:00, so anyone working late will need the weekend access code. Issue it only to rostered staff. The code is below.

badge for bawef-bahap: bdg-LALUM-4